Parents of teenagers approaching 17 and 18 years of age may be thinking about college, job prospects, and other post-high school adventures. But for parents of a teen with an intellectual or developmental disability, exploring the possibility of establishing legal guardianship should be a top priority.

The New York State AFL-CIO sent a strong signal to State Senator Darrel Aubertine that union leaders are disappointed in him.
The union issued scores of endorsements Monday in races ranging from the Governor’s race to the dozens of State Assembly contests.
But in his district, two words: No endorsement.
